# This is an expect (tcl) library of procedures to aid network testing
# These functions provide support for pre-built test cases which can be
# provided arguments to indicate the network to be tested
## tcl procedures to support testing:
## =============================================
proc test_case_ping1 { host desthosts ulp suffix mtu { punchlist 0 } } {
##
## test_case_ping1
## -------------------
## execute a test case to perform basic 1 packet pings
## from host to each of desthosts
##
## Usage:
## test_cases_ping1 host desthosts ulp suffix mtu [punchlist]
## Arguments:
## host - host to initiate ping from
## desthosts - list of hosts to send to
## ulp - protocol being used
## suffix - hostname suffix for network ($env(CFG_IPOIB_SUFFIX),
## or $env(CFG_INIC_SUFFIX) or "")
## Only used for integration tests, when used by FastFabric, set to ""
## mtu - MTU for network
## punchlist - should punchlist be updated on failure (default=0=no)
## Returns:
## nothing
## Additional Information:
## must be used within a test_suite's body, performs test_case calls
## uses case_setup and case_cleanup provided by caller
## no item_setup nor item_cleanup used
global env
#Substract 28 from the mtu, 20 Byte IP header and 8 Byte ICMP header
# because we dont want to fragment icmp packet.See PR 111259
set ping_size [ expr $mtu - 28 ]
test_case "$host\_ping1" "simple ping from $host" "perform simple 1 packet $ping_size byte pings from $host using $ulp
to $desthosts
File: TestTools/network.exp" case_setup case_cleanup {
upvar host host
upvar ulp ulp
upvar suffix suffix
upvar ping_size ping_size
upvar desthosts desthosts
upvar punchlist punchlist
target_root_sh $host
set target_os_type [target_get_os_type]
foreach desthost $desthosts {
# allow ping of self
if { [ catch { set res [
test_item "$desthost" "$host to $desthost" "simple ping from $host to $desthost" noop noop {
set netdest "[ host_basename $desthost ]$suffix"
send_unix_cmd "/usr/lib/opa/tools/opagetipaddrtype $netdest"
set out [expect_any 60 {"ipv6" "ipv4" } {"Error:" "Usage:"}]
regexp {([ip]+)([A-Za-z0-9]+)} $out iptype
if { $iptype == "ipv4" } {
set PING "ping"
} else {
set PING "ping6"
}
send_unix_cmd "$PING -W 5 -c 1 -s $ping_size $netdest"
# AS2.1 ping has slightly different output than 7.3 ping
expect_any 60 { "1 packets transmitted" "1 transmitted" } { "unknown" "refused" "error" "timeout" " 0 packets received" " 0 received" "nreachable" "duplicates" }
expect_any 60 { " 1 received" " 1 packets received" } { "unknown" "refused" "error" "timeout" " 0 packets received" " 0 received" "nreachable" "duplicates" }
expect_any 60 { " 0% loss" "0% packet loss" } { "unknown" "refused" "error" "timeout" " 0 packets received" " 0 received" "nreachable" "duplicates" }
expect_any 60 { "time " "round-trip" } { "unknown" "refused" "error" "timeout" " 0 packets received" " 0 received" "nreachable" "duplicates" }
check_exit_status 60 0
} ] } err_str2 ] != 0 || $res != 0 } {
if { $punchlist } {
append_punchlist "$desthost" "unable to ping via $ulp"
}
}
}
target_root_sh_exit
}
}
